3d建模师需要学什么知识
3D建模师要想在这个领域崭露头角,必须掌握一系列丰富且系统的知识体系。
一、数学基础
数学在3D建模中扮演着不可或缺的角色,首先要熟知点、线、面、体这些最基本的几何概念,它们是构建3D模型的基础元素。例如,一个复杂的游戏角色模型,便是由无数个点、线、面巧妙组合而成。同时,几何变换知识也至关重要,通过平移、旋转、缩放等变换操作,能够让模型呈现出各种不同的姿态和位置关系。投影知识则帮助建模师理解如何将三维物体呈现在二维屏幕上,为模型的展示和渲染提供理论支持。
二、色彩与审美
色彩搭配的基本原理和技巧,3D建模师必须掌握的另一项重要内容。了解色彩的色相、明度、纯度等属性,以及它们之间相互搭配所产生的视觉效果,能够使建模师设计出色彩协调、富有吸引力的3D模型。例如,在创建一个梦幻风格的游戏场景时,通过巧妙运用暖色调营造温馨、欢快的氛围;而在打造恐怖游戏场景时,则多采用冷色调来增强压抑、惊悚的感觉。
三、3D建模软件
熟练掌握至少一款专业的3D建模软件是3D建模师的必备技能。Maya、3dsMax、Blender等软件在行业内应用广泛,它们各自拥有丰富的工具和功能,为建模师提供了强大的创作支持。
Maya以其强大的动画功能和多边形建模能力著称,在影视特效和游戏角色动画制作领域占据重要地位。通过它,建模师能够创建出高精度、动作流畅的角色模型和动画效果。3dsMax则在建筑设计、室内装饰以及游戏场景搭建方面表现出色,其操作相对简单直观,拥有丰富的插件资源,能够大大提高建模效率。Blender作为一款开源免费的软件,功能也十分强大,涵盖建模、雕刻、动画、渲染等多个方面,并且拥有活跃的社区,方便建模师交流学习。
四、计算机图形学基础
计算机图形学的基本原理和算法对于3D建模师而言,犹如一把打开深入理解3D世界大门的钥匙。了解光栅化、三角剖分、光照模型等概念,能够帮助建模师优化和提升建模效果。
光栅化是将矢量图形转换为光栅图像的过程,理解这一概念有助于建模师更好地把握模型在屏幕上的显示效果。三角剖分则是将复杂的多边形模型分解为三角形网格,这是3D建模中常用的模型表示方法,能够提高模型的处理效率和渲染速度。光照模型决定了光线如何与模型表面相互作用,不同的光照模型能够营造出不同的光影效果,从真实感极强的物理光照模型到风格化的卡通光照模型,建模师需要根据项目需求选择合适的光照模型,为模型增添逼真的光影效果。
成为一名优秀的3D建模师需要学习和掌握多方面的知识,只有全面系统地学习这些知识,并不断实践和积累经验,才能在3D建模领域中发挥出自己的创造力,打造出令人惊叹的3D作品。